### Recovery note — Pinwright policy account

For the weekly eng sync: our dependency pinning policy is enforced by the Pinwright service account, which must never be casually reset, as unpinned builds would pass silently. If the account is lost, recovery follows the documented two-person procedure and requires the passphrase recorded just below.

strongbox words: gilok-druion-briath-wendor-briion-prawyn-fenion-oliir-casdor-holius-briius-gilath-gilael-pelys

Subject: Pilot Churn Update — Lanternway Programme

Team, a brief update for sales leads ahead of Thursday's review. Churn in the Lanternway pilot reached 11% this quarter, up from 7%. Exit interviews point to onboarding friction rather than pricing; most departing accounts cited slow configuration of the Relay dashboard. Remediation steps are underway, including a revised setup guide and weekly check-ins led by Customer Success. Full figures are in the attached deck. The confidential planning note relevant to this follows below.

confidential, kagup-bafog: Fraaxax Group is in early talks to buy Soroxox Group for about $343.8 million. The Olidor launch date is June 14, and nothing goes to the press before then. Legal wants the Aldmirek Logistics term sheet signed before July 23.

Subject: Scheduled key rotation for SQLint plugin endpoints

Hello plugin authors,

As part of our quarterly security cycle, Tablewright is rotating the credentials used by the SQLint rules service. This affects any plugin that fetches shared lint rule packs for SQL files at build time. The old key stops working at the end of the month. Please update your plugin configuration to use the new internal service key below.

service key, kaduf-bawig: kto15_Ze79S0dligTw0yO

## Timezone Handling in Exports

All report timestamps in Ledgerfall are stored as UTC and converted at export time using the workspace's configured zone, never the requesting user's browser zone. If a customer reports shifted dates, first confirm the workspace setting, then check whether the export predates the Marlow migration, which normalized legacy offsets. Do not patch rows manually. The conversion matrix and known edge cases are maintained on the following internal page.

dashboard of bafof-hafog = https://confluence.lumiclabs.internal/display/browse/display/6a09a20a